Revolutionizing Military Mobility with Composite Rubber Tracks

The military industry has always been at the forefront of technological advancements, continuously seeking ways to enhance the performance and durability of its equipment. One of the significant innovations reshaping military vehicle capabilities is the development and implementation of composite rubber tracks. These tracks are transforming ground operations by offering a range of advantages over traditional steel tracks.

Understanding Composite Rubber Tracks

Composite rubber tracks are designed using layers of rubber compounds combined with materials like steel and other composites. This construction allows them to offer a blend of flexibility, strength, and resilience. Unlike the conventional all-steel tracks, composite rubber tracks are specifically engineered to reduce weight while maintaining durability.

Key Benefits of Composite Rubber Tracks

  • Reduced Weight: The integration of rubber reduces the overall weight of the tracks, improving fuel efficiency and vehicle speed without compromising on strength.
  • Increased Durability: The composite materials offer enhanced resistance to wear and tear, leading to a longer lifespan than traditional tracks.
  • Noise Reduction: Operation with rubber tracks is significantly quieter, providing a strategic advantage in stealth operations.
  • Improved Traction: The flexibility of rubber allows for better grip on various terrains, from muddy fields to icy roads, enhancing maneuverability.

Application in Modern Military Vehicles

Composite rubber tracks are being adopted in various types of military vehicles, from light tactical vehicles to heavy armored tanks. Their ability to provide a smoother ride with less vibration is particularly beneficial for sensitive equipment and personnel comfort. This technology supports a wide range of vehicle specifications, ensuring adaptability across different models.

Feature Steel Tracks Composite Rubber Tracks
Weight Heavy Lightweight
Durability High but prone to corrosion Very High and corrosion-resistant
Noise Level Loud Quiet
Traction Good Excellent
Cost Moderate High initial cost but longer lifetime

Challenges and Considerations

While the benefits of composite rubber tracks are compelling, there are several considerations for military planners. The initial cost of these tracks can be higher than traditional steel tracks. However, the longer operational life and lower maintenance requirements often justify the investment. Furthermore, ensuring the availability of materials and manufacturing capabilities can be a logistical challenge but essential for widespread use.

Future Prospects

As technology continues to advance, the development of composite rubber tracks will likely see further innovation. Research into new materials and construction techniques could lead to even lighter and stronger tracks. Enhanced environmental adaptability and integration with autonomous vehicle technologies may also be on the horizon, providing even greater tactical advantages to military forces worldwide.

A Strategic Leap Forward

The adoption of composite rubber tracks marks a significant leap forward in military vehicle technology. By offering superior mobility, quieter operation, and reduced wear, these tracks enhance the operational capabilities of military forces. As the technology matures, it will undoubtedly play a pivotal role in shaping the future of military logistics and ground operations.
